Interacts with the Government regarding Systems Engineering technical considerations and associated problems, issues, or conflicts. Communicates with other program personnel, government overseers, and senior executives. Responsibility for the technical integrity, quality, and completeness of work performed and deliverables associated with one or more of the 25 process areas defined by ISO/IEC15288:\n\nTechnical Process Area - Stakeholder Requirements Definition, Requirements Analysis, Architectural Design, Implementation, Integration, Verification, Transition, Validation, Operation, Maintenance, and Disposal.\nProject Process Area - Project Planning, Project Assessment and Control, Decision Management, Risk Management, Configuration Management, Information Management, and Measurement.\nEnterprise (Organizational Project-Enabling) Process Area - Project Portfolio Management, Infrastructure Management, Lifecycle Model Management, Human Resource Management, and Quality Management.\nAgreement Process Area - Acquisition and Supply.\n,\nRequired Skills\n\nA High School Diploma or GED plus fourteen (14) years of general system engineering experience.\nA Bachelor’s degree in a Qualified Engineering Field or a related discipline from an accredited college or university plus ten (10) years of systems engineering experience.\nA Master’s degree in a Qualified Engineering Field or a related discipline from an accredited college or university, plus eight (8) years of systems engineering experience.\nA PhD in a Qualified Engineering Field or a related discipline from an accredited college or university, plus eight (8) years of systems engineering experience.\nActive TS/SCI security clearance with a current polygraph is required.\n,\nDesired Skills\n\nCloud Architecture/ Cloud Engineer/ Platform Engineering (especially in AWS)\nAI/ML system design and implementation\nHigh-level understanding of the AI lifecycle (development, training, inference, monitoring)\nExperience with ML pipeline development, model deployment, and DevOps/MLOps\nExperience with Amazon SageMaker is a plus\nExcellent communication and collaboration skills with a variety of stakeholder groups, ability to proactively engage with these groups to understand requirements and inform system architecture decisions\nSystem security and networking (particularly the implementation of system security on classified systems)\nData engineering and data lifecycle management\n,\nAdditional Details\n\nAt CyberCore, we believe in taking care of our employees both inside and outside the workplace.
